A 11-minute walk from Odoi Beach, Atarayo Nishiizu Onsen provides recently renovated 3-star accommodations in the Toi Onsen district of Izu. The ryokan offers a spa experience, with its hot spring bath, public bath, and open-air bath. The ryokan features rooms with air conditioning, free private parking, and free Wifi. Each room has a kettle, a flat-screen TV, and a safety deposit box, while some rooms include a terrace and some have sea views. At the ryokan, each unit has a private bathroom with a hair dryer and free toiletries. An Asian breakfast is available at the ryokan. Guests are welcome to eat at the on-site traditional restaurant, which is open for dinner. Koibito Misaki Cape is 5.1 miles from Atarayo Nishiizu Onsen, while Mount Daruma is 12 miles from the property.

IItt-KoyArai Ryokan, built in 1872, is a luxurious ryokan with 31 Japanese style guest rooms are located in various private cottages. Its 15 wooden structures are registered as the national cultural assets. Many Japanese celebrated artists made frequent visit and the big art collection is housed in the ryokan. A wooden bridge leads to the guest rooms which overlook either the river or the courtyard with its large pond full of carp. Arai Ryokan’s traditional Japanese cuisine kaiseki served features local fresh seafood and vegetable of each season.
